US Considers Rolling Back Tariffs
Ahead of China Trade Deal.
The move comes as the two
countries prepare to sign a
“phase one deal” sometime
this month.
Reuters reports that an official has said that
the U.S. is expected to roll back $112 billion worth
of tariffs on Chinese goods imposed in September.
In return, China will be expected to purchase
more goods from U.S. farmers and provide
better protection for intellectual property.
The high stakes trade war was initially caused
by a dispute over IP theft over a year ago.
The deal is expected to bring relief to the global economy, which the dispute has affected for the past 15 months
